Abstract
A video information transfer and display system having a plurality of video display devices and apparatus to select for display at particular display devices, on the basis of identification data incorporated within the video signals, predetermined video display information from sequential video signals also received at many other display sites. Video recorders are adapted to record selected portions of commercial television-type video signals and maintain the image displayed on associated television receivers.

2. A video information transfer system comprising video display means, means to receive signals for display by said video display means, means to identify particular portions of said received signals, means to record signals received by said signal receiving means, means activating said recording meAns during receipt of said identified signal portions, said activated recording means then recording the identified portion of the received video signals, means utilizing said recorded portion to maintain on said video display the information contained within said identified signal portion, means associated with at least one identification means for originating and sending a user-originated video display to a video recording means, means responsive to said identification means for initiating the sending of at least a part of the video frame from said user-originated means, and means for routing said user-originated video frame to any required intermediate and final video recording means.
